#bbdad4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bbdad4 is composed of 73.3% red, 85.5%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.8%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 168.4 degrees, a saturation of 29.5% and a lightness of 79.4%. #bbdad4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#77b5a9.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#bbdad4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040807 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#bbdad4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c7cecd is the less saturated color, while #97feea is the most saturated one.
